Comparison Summary

1. Specifications Comparison

Design

FeatureOppo Find X3 ProSamsung Galaxy A05Practical Impact
Dimensions163.6 × 74 × 8.3 mm168.8 × 78.2 × 8.8 mmThe A05 is slightly larger and thicker, potentially feeling less comfortable in one hand for some users.
Weight193g195gBoth phones are nearly the same weight, so there won't be a noticeable difference in hand feel.
BuildCorning Gorilla Glass 5 FrontUnknown Screen ProtectionThe Find X3 Pro's screen offers superior scratch and drop protection.

Display

FeatureOppo Find X3 ProSamsung Galaxy A05Practical Impact
Size6.7"6.7"Both have the same screen size.
Resolution1440x3216720x1600The Find X3 Pro has a much sharper display (302% more pixels) with significantly more detail, noticeably better for reading, viewing photos, and watching videos.
PPI525262The Find X3 Pro will look substantially sharper with greater clarity and better text rendering due to its high pixel density.
TechnologyAMOLEDPLS LCDThe Find X3 Pro's AMOLED display offers deeper blacks, better contrast, and more vibrant colors, leading to a richer viewing experience.
Refresh Rate120Hz60HzThe Find X3 Pro has smoother scrolling and animations, resulting in a more fluid feel, especially in gaming or fast-paced content.
Brightness1300 nits0 nitsThe Find X3 Pro is much brighter, making it far more usable outdoors in sunlight. The Galaxy A05 has an unknown brightness, likely much lower and may be difficult to view outdoors.

Performance

FeatureOppo Find X3 ProSamsung Galaxy A05Practical Impact
ChipsetQualcomm Snapdragon 888 5G (5 nm)Mediatek Helio G85 (12 nm)The Find X3 Pro's processor is considerably more powerful, offering much faster app loading, smoother multitasking, and better gaming performance.
AnTuTu Score876,500225,154The Find X3 Pro is significantly faster in all areas, handling demanding tasks and games without breaking a sweat.
GPUAdreno 660Mali-G52 MC2The Find X3 Pro has a much more capable GPU, leading to better graphics performance in games and other GPU-intensive tasks.

Camera

FeatureOppo Find X3 ProSamsung Galaxy A05Practical Impact
Standard Camera50MP, f/1.8, 1/1.56" sensor, Sony IMX76650MP, f/1.8Both have a 50MP main camera. However, the Find X3 Pro has a larger sensor and a high-quality Sony sensor, likely resulting in better low-light and dynamic range.
Selfie Camera32MP, f/2.4, 1/2.74" sensor, Sony IMX6158MP, f/2.0The Find X3 Pro's selfie camera captures much more detail. The A05 has a slightly wider aperture which could be slightly better in low light, but the Find X3 Pro's higher resolution will produce much sharper images overall.
Telephoto Lens13MP, f/2.4, 1/3.4" sensorNot availableThe Find X3 Pro can optically zoom closer without losing image quality.
Wide Angle Lens50MP, f/2.2, 1/1.56" sensorNot availableThe Find X3 Pro has an additional 50MP wide angle lens, offering more versatility.
Portrait Mode (Depth)Not available2MP, f/2.4The A05 has a dedicated depth sensor for better portrait mode effects.
Video RecordingUp to 4K@60fps, HDR, EIS1080p@60fpsThe Find X3 Pro records much higher quality video with more advanced features (HDR, EIS) for better stabilization and dynamic range.
Camera FeaturesQuadruple Camera, OIS, PDAF, RAW, etc.Dual Camera, Basic AutofocusThe Find X3 Pro is equipped with many more camera features for advanced control and quality.
DxOMarkOverall: 128, Photo: 134, Video: 125Not testedThe Find X3 Pro has a much higher camera score, according to DxOMark.

Battery

FeatureOppo Find X3 ProSamsung Galaxy A05Practical Impact
Capacity4500 mAh5000 mAhThe A05 has a larger battery for potentially longer usage between charges.
Charging65W Fast Charging, Li-Polymer25W Fast Charging, Li-IonThe Find X3 Pro charges much faster, a full charge in less time, significantly more convenient.
Battery FeaturesReverse charging, 30W wireless, reverse wirelessNon-removableThe Find X3 Pro offers more advanced charging options, including wireless charging and reverse charging.

2. Key Differences Analysis

Oppo Find X3 Pro Advantages:

  • Superior Display: Sharper, more vibrant AMOLED panel with 120Hz refresh rate and much higher brightness.
  • Flagship Performance: Much more powerful processor and GPU for demanding tasks and smooth gaming.
  • Versatile Camera System: More capable main sensor, dedicated telephoto and wide-angle lenses, higher quality video recording.
  • Faster Charging: Significantly faster 65W wired charging and 30W wireless charging.
  • Advanced Features: Wireless charging, Reverse charging, Stereo speakers, Dolby Atmos, more comprehensive sensor suite

Practical Implications: The Find X3 Pro provides a premium, high-performance experience with a superior display, better camera, and faster charging, ideal for power users and those who value image quality.

Samsung Galaxy A05 Advantages:

  • Larger Battery: Offers potentially longer battery life between charges, for users who prioritize endurance.
  • Newer Bluetooth: Bluetooth 5.3 is slightly newer, but the real-world impact is minimal.
  • Lower Price: Likely to be a much more budget-friendly device.
  • More Recent Android Version: Comes with Android 13 out of the box, with an unknown upgrade path.

Practical Implications: The Galaxy A05 is a more affordable option, suitable for basic tasks, with potentially longer battery life. Ideal for light users who don't need top performance or a high-end camera.

Significant Trade-offs:

  • The Oppo Find X3 Pro sacrifices battery capacity for a more powerful experience and significantly faster charging.
  • The Samsung Galaxy A05 sacrifices performance, display quality, and camera capabilities for a lower price and slightly longer battery life.
  • The Oppo Find X3 Pro was released nearly 3 years ago, the Samsung Galaxy A05 was released much more recently.
